Performance on Challenging Fabrics & Surfaces

Stitching Mini Bumblebee on stretchy fabric (a lightweight sweatshirt) required a light cutaway stabilizer—not heavy, but firm enough to prevent puckering around the wing edges. On dark fabric, I swapped standard black thread for matte charcoal, which preserved definition without glare. For curved surfaces like caps, I used a smaller hoop size and repositioned the design slightly lower on the front panel to avoid distortion near the crown seam. The stitch density feels moderate—not sparse, not overly dense—so it holds up through repeated washing on baby blankets and kitchen towels without fraying or stiffness.

Practical Notes Before You Stitch

Before adding Mini Bumblebee to your next order, take these steps:

  1. Test on scrap fabric matching your final substrate—even slight variations in weave or weight affect how satin stitch lies.
  2. Review thread color contrast, especially if stitching on heathered or textured fabrics where subtle tones can disappear.
  3. Confirm hoop size and file dimensions—while compact, some versions may include optional outlines or alternate wing treatments.
  4. Compare mockups on light and dark fabric using your preferred design software or printable mockup templates.
  5. Use appropriate stabilizer: tear-away for stable wovens, cutaway for knits or high-wear items like towels.
  6. Inspect small details post-stitch: antennae tips and wing edges should be crisp—not fuzzy or flattened by excess tension.
  7. Verify licensing terms on the Creative Fabrica product page before selling finished items—especially for commercial embroidery or digital resale bundles.
